The Malaysian prime minister described the Jews as "cross-eyed" and blamed them for creating the unrest in the Middle East, reviving accusations of anti-Semitism.

Mahathir Mohamad, who at 93 became the world's oldest head of government after starting his second term as prime minister in May, has been accused of anti-Semitism for his attacks on Jews, which he has accused of perpetrating a humanitarian crisis in the Palestinian territories. .

"If you want to be honest, the problem in the Middle East began with the creation of Israel. That's the truth. But I can not say that, "he said in an interview for the BBC's Hard Talk magazine.

Calling the "special" Israelis, Mahathir disputed historical accounts that 6 million Jews were killed in the Holocaust, claiming that the figure was 4 million.

Asked about the description of the Jews in his book The Malay Dilemma, he replied: "They have their nose crossed. Many people have called the nose-nosed Malays. We did not object, we did not fight for it. "

The Anti-Defamation League, a US-based anti-Semitism-based organization, was not immediately available to comment, but attacked the "story of anti-Semitic conspiracy theories of Mahathir," published many decades ago. a tweet in may. "The world can not accept that from any leader," reads in the tweet.

Last week, during his address to the United Nations General Assembly in New York, Mahathir declared that the world "rewards Israel" for breaking international laws and committing acts of terrorism against Palestinians.
